> My example before wasn’t the best, I think.  Here’s a more concrete 
> one: I want to write a function that will center an element in its 
> viewport.

Just wrap the element in two <g> elements, the outer one having a <g 
x="50%"> and the inner one having <g x="-...px"> where ... is half the 
bounding box (which you can obtain through the DOM).
